The Levi distillery is the daughter of a great tradition and thanks to Lidia and Romano Levi, it has met art, dressing up with labels made by great names, becoming collectors' items. Romano Levi, nicknamed "il Grappaiolo Angelico" by Luigi Veronelli, inherited the distillery in the Langhe region of Neive from his father Serafino when he was just 17 years old. He kept the same and only discontinuous direct-fire copper still he worked with for 63 years, which is still the only one in the world still in operation today. His sister Lidia, on the other hand, was always busy studying the marc and researching aromatic herbs. Today the distillery-house is a living museum that continues to distil according to tradition, thanks to friends who still jealously guard the last grappas still left to age in casks. They are fiery grappas, 'wild' as the Maestro liked to call them, with a unique and inimitable taste.

Description

Grappa di Barolo is the only Italian grappa recognised at European level as 'Geographical Indication', which characterises its origin and production regulations. The Grappa di Barolo produced by the Romano Levi distillery is made from Barolo marc from the areas of Barolo, Serralunga, La Morra and Grinzane Cavour. The marc, fresh and still dripping with must, is immediately compressed in underground pits in order to obtain a natural tanning process capable of extracting the most varietal aromas. Vinification 

The marc, fresh and still dripping with must, is immediately compressed in underground pits in order to obtain a natural tanning process capable of extracting the most varietal aromas. Distillation takes place in a discontinuous copper pot still that operates on direct fire. At the end of the process, the Grappa is transferred into classic Piedmontese oak casks of approximately 700 litres, where it is left to rest for 38 months.
